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of electric vehicle controller technology, specifically to a terminal cover structure for an electric vehicle controller. Background Technology
[0002] Electric vehicle controller terminal cover is a safety component used to protect terminals or connecting wires. The terminal cover can cover the terminal connection to effectively prevent dust intrusion.
[0003] Chinese Patent Publication No. CN220554190U discloses a terminal cover structure for an electric vehicle controller, including a cover and a terminal base, which are snap-fitted together. The cover has an inner surface in which a snap-fit is provided. The terminal base is mounted on the housing of the controller and includes two side walls, each side wall having an outer surface in which a guide groove is provided and the snap-fit is located within the guide groove.
[0004] The cover plate of this utility model is easy to deform and has a convenient snap-fit connection with the terminal base for easy disassembly.
[0005] In the aforementioned prior art, the orientation of the wire hole in the terminal cover is always fixed, which means that the connecting wire can only be connected to the terminal from a fixed direction. It is not convenient to adjust the orientation when wiring. If the installation space of the electric vehicle controller is limited, the orientation can only be changed by bending the connecting wire at the terminal. Bending may cause the connecting terminal to loosen or be damaged. Utility Model Content

[0008] A terminal cover structure for an electric vehicle controller includes:
[0009] Electric vehicle controller;
[0010] Metal terminals are located on the electric vehicle controller and are used for wiring.
[0011] A protective structure, arranged on the metal terminal, is used to enclose and protect the metal terminal;
[0012] A locking structure, arranged on the protective structure, is used to lock the opening and closing of the protective structure;
[0013] The extrusion structure, placed on the protective structure, is used to fix the extruded connecting wires.
[0014] Preferably, the protective structure includes:
[0015] A fixed plate is fixedly sleeved on a metal terminal;
[0016] The protective cover is rotatably mounted on the fixed plate;
[0017] The cover plate is rotatably mounted on the protective cover. The cover plate and the protective cover are used together to wrap the metal terminals.
[0018] Two wire-passing holes are respectively opened inside the protective cover and the cover plate for wire passing;
[0019] A rotating component is arranged on the protective cover, enabling the cover to be flipped.
[0020] Preferably, the rotating assembly includes:
[0021] An annular groove is formed inside the fixed plate;
[0022] A limiting ring is arranged inside the protective cover, and the limiting ring is rotatably installed inside the annular groove.
[0023] Preferably, the rotating assembly further includes a pressing screw, which is threaded inside the protective cover and contacts the surface of the fixed plate to press against the surface of the fixed plate to limit the angle of the protective cover.
[0024] Preferably, the locking structure includes:
[0025] The L-shaped hanging rod is rotatably mounted on one side of the protective cover;
[0026] An L-shaped latch is arranged on one side of the cover plate, and the L-shaped hanging rod can be detachably installed on the L-shaped latch.
[0027] Preferably, the locking structure further includes:
[0028] A fixed shaft is arranged on one side of the protective cover. The fixed shaft is rotatably installed inside the L-shaped hanging rod and serves as the rotation fulcrum of the L-shaped hanging rod.
[0029] A torsion spring is fitted onto a fixed shaft. One end of the torsion spring is located on the inner wall of the L-shaped hanging rod, and the other end of the torsion spring is located on the surface of the fixed shaft.
[0030] Preferably, the extrusion structure includes:
[0031] Two threaded seats are arranged on one side of the cover plate;
[0032] A flexible plastic strip is positioned below the two threaded seats;
[0033] Two movable screws are threadedly installed inside two threaded seats, respectively;
[0034] Two extrusion plates are respectively arranged at one end of two movable screws for extruding flexible plastic strips.
[0035] Preferably, the extrusion structure further includes a plurality of protrusions arranged on one side of the flexible plastic strip to increase friction when pressed against the connecting line.
[0036] The beneficial eff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0037] This invention, through the cooperation of the protective cover and the cover plate, can wrap and protect the wiring end of the metal terminal, and the rotation of the pressing screw can release the angle restriction of the protective cover. At this time, the orientation of the wire hole can be adjusted by rotating the protective cover. It can be adjusted according to the wiring orientation of the connecting wire, so that the connecting wire does not need to be bent at the joint to adjust its orientation when the wire is routed. At the same time, the protective cover and the cover plate can maintain the wrapping and protection of the connection.
[0038] In this invention, when the cover plate flips to close the protective cover, the flexible plastic strip will press against the connecting line. After the cover plate is locked, the corresponding movable screw can be rotated to make the extrusion plate squeeze the flexible plastic strip. The squeezed flexible plastic strip can stick tightly to the connecting line and press on its surface, thereby improving the connection stability of the connecting line and preventing it from loosening when pulled by external force. [0048] Example 1:
[0049]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, this utility model provides a terminal cover structure for an electric vehicle controller, including: an electric vehicle controller 1 and metal terminals 2 arranged on the electric vehicle controller 1 for wiring, a protective structure arranged on the metal terminals 2 for wrapping and protecting the metal terminals 2, and a locking structure arranged on the protective structure for locking the opening and closing of the protective structure.
[0050] The protective structure includes a fixed plate 3 fixedly sleeved on the metal terminal 2, a protective cover 301 rotatably sleeved on the fixed plate 3, and a cover plate 302 rotatably installed on the protective cover 301. The cover plate 302 cooperates with the protective cover 301 to wrap the metal terminal 2. Two wire-passing holes 306 are respectively opened inside the protective cover 301 and the cover plate 302 for wire passing. A rotating component is arranged on the protective cover 301 to enable the protective cover 301 to be flipped. The connector of the connecting wire is inserted into the protective cover 301 and aligned with the connection hole on the metal terminal 2. Then, a bolt is used to pass through the connector and screw it into the metal terminal 2 to fix the connecting wire. Then, the cover plate 302 is flipped to wrap the connection between the connector and the metal terminal 2.
[0051] Specifically, the rotating component includes an annular groove 303 inside the fixed plate 3 and a limiting ring 304 arranged inside the protective cover 301. The limiting ring 304 is rotatably installed inside the annular groove 303. When the protective cover 301 rotates, it can drive the limiting ring 304 to rotate within the annular groove 303. The arrangement of the annular groove 303 and the annular groove 304 can prevent the protective cover 301 from detaching from the fixed plate 3.
[0052] Specifically, the rotating assembly also includes a pressing screw 305 threaded inside the protective cover 301 for pressing against the surface of the fixed disk 3 to limit the angle of the protective cover 301. The pressing screw 305 is in contact with the surface of the fixed disk 3. By rotating the pressing screw 305, it can be released from the pressure on the surface of the fixed disk 3, thereby releasing the angle restriction on the protective cover 301. Conversely, when the pressing screw 305 is pressed against the surface of the fixed disk 3, it can fix the current angle of the protective cover 301.
[0053] The locking structure includes an L-shaped hanging rod 4 rotatably mounted on one side of the protective cover 301 and an L-shaped locking rod 401 arranged on one side of the cover plate 302. The L-shaped hanging rod 4 is detachably mounted on the L-shaped locking rod 401. When in use, the L-shaped hanging rod 4 is first flipped to avoid the L-shaped locking rod 401. When the cover plate 302 is flipped to cover the connection between the connector and the metal terminal 2, the cover plate 302 can be locked by flipping the L-shaped hanging rod 4 to hook onto the L-shaped locking rod 401.
[0054] The locking structure also includes a fixed shaft 402 arranged on one side of the protective cover 301 as the fulcrum for the rotation of the L-shaped hanging rod 4. The fixed shaft 402 is rotatably installed inside the L-shaped hanging rod 4. A torsion spring 403 is sleeved on the fixed shaft 402. One end of the torsion spring 403 is arranged on the inner wall of the L-shaped hanging rod 4, and the other end of the torsion spring 403 is arranged on the surface of the fixed shaft 402. When the L-shaped hanging rod 4 is flipped, the torsion spring 403 will be compressed. When the L-shaped hanging rod 4 is released, the compressed torsion spring 403 will be released and drive the L-shaped hanging rod 4 to flip back to its original position.
[0055] Example 2:
[0056] Based on Example 1, in order to further improve the stability of the connecting wire during installation, a compression structure for squeezing and fixing the connecting wire is arranged on the protective structure.
[0057] The extrusion structure includes two threaded seats 5 arranged on one side of the cover plate 302, a flexible plastic strip 501 arranged below the two threaded seats 5, two movable screws 502 respectively threaded inside the two threaded seats 5, and two extrusion plates 503 arranged at one end of the two movable screws 502 for extruding the flexible plastic strip 501. When the cover plate 302 flips to close the protective cover 301, it can drive the flexible plastic strip 501 to press against the connecting line. After the cover plate 302 is locked, the movable screws 502 on both sides can be rotated to drive the extrusion plates 503 to further extrude the flexible plastic strip 501 and press it tightly against the connecting line.
[0058] The extrusion structure also includes a protrusion 504 arranged on one side of the flexible plastic strip 501 to increase friction when pressed against the connecting line. When the flexible plastic strip 501 is extruded, it can drive the protrusion 504 to further press against the connecting line, increase the friction with the connecting line, and improve the fastening effect.
[0059] Working principle: Refer to the wiring instructions. Figure 3 To fix the cable, first adjust the angle between the protective cover 301 and the cover plate 302 according to the direction the connecting cable needs to be laid. During adjustment, rotate the pressure screw 305. The pressure screw 305 moves through its threaded engagement with the protective cover 301, releasing it from the pressure on the surface of the fixing plate 3, thus releasing the angle restriction on the protective cover 301. Then, flip the protective cover 301 to adjust its angle. After adjusting the angle, insert the connector of the connecting cable into the protective cover 301 and align it with the connection hole on the metal terminal 2. Then, use a bolt to pass through the connector and screw it into the metal terminal 2 to fix the connecting cable. The connecting cable rests on the wire hole 306. Next, flip the L-shaped hanging rod 4 to avoid the L-shaped locking rod 401. When the L-shaped hanging rod 4 flips, it rotates on the fixed shaft 402 and compresses the torsion spring 403. Then, the cover plate 302 is flipped to cover the connection between the connector and the metal terminal 2. After the cover plate 302 contacts the protective cover 301, the L-shaped hanging rod 4 can be released. At this time, the compressed torsion spring 403 will be released and drive the L-shaped hanging rod 4 to flip and reset, so that the L-shaped hanging rod 4 hooks onto the L-shaped locking rod 401, locking the cover plate 302 to prevent it from flipping and loosening. At the same time as the cover plate 302 flips to close the protective cover 301, it can also drive the protrusion 504 on the flexible plastic strip 501 to press against the connecting line. After the cover plate 302 is locked, the movable screws 502 on both sides can be rotated. When the movable screws 502 rotate, they can move through the threaded engagement with the threaded seat 5, so that the movable screws 502 drive the extrusion plate 503 to further extrude the flexible plastic strip 501, so that the protrusion 504 on the flexible plastic strip 501 can stick tightly to the connecting line, and reinforce and fix the connecting line.
